As I sat on my porch swing, wrapped in a cozy blanket with the crisp autumn air brushing against my face, I pressed play on “The Girl with All the Gifts Audiobook”. From the very first chapter, I was transported into a world that felt both hauntingly familiar and eerily alien. M.R. Carey’s storytelling is nothing short of masterful, weaving together themes of humanity, survival, and morality in a way that left me questioning my own beliefs long after the final chapter.

Finty Williams’ narration was absolutely captivating. Her ability to bring Melanie’s innocence and curiosity to life while also conveying the underlying tension of this dystopian world was remarkable. The subtle shifts in her tone perfectly mirrored the emotional complexity of each character, making it impossible not to feel deeply connected to their struggles. The pacing of her delivery kept me on edge throughout, especially during moments of suspense or heartbreak.

What struck me most about this audiobook was how it defied expectations. At its core, “The Girl with All the Gifts” is not just another post-apocalyptic thriller – it’s a profound exploration of what it means to be human. Melanie’s journey is both heartbreaking and inspiring, forcing listeners to confront uncomfortable truths about love, sacrifice, and survival. The relationship between Melanie and Miss Justineau added layers of emotional depth that lingered with me for days.

There were moments when I had to pause just to catch my breath or process what I had just heard. The story doesn’t shy away from darkness but balances it beautifully with glimmers of hope and resilience. By the end, I found myself reflecting on how far we would go for those we care about – and whether kindness can truly prevail in a broken world.
